package com.android.voicemail.impl.scheduling;

import android.content.Context;
import android.content.Intent;
import android.os.SystemClock;
import android.support.annotation.CallSuper;
import android.support.annotation.MainThread;
import android.support.annotation.NonNull;
import android.support.annotation.WorkerThread;
import android.telecom.PhoneAccountHandle;
import com.android.voicemail.impl.Assert;
import com.android.voicemail.impl.NeededForTesting;
import java.util.ArrayList;
import java.util.List;

/**
 * Provides common utilities for task implementations, such as execution time and managing {@link
 * Policy}
 */
public abstract class BaseTask implements Task {

  private static final String EXTRA_PHONE_ACCOUNT_HANDLE = "extra_phone_account_handle";

  private Context mContext;

  private int mId;
  private PhoneAccountHandle mPhoneAccountHandle;

  private boolean mHasStarted;
  private volatile boolean mHasFailed;

  @NonNull private final List<Policy> mPolicies = new ArrayList<>();

  private long mExecutionTime;

  private static Clock sClock = new Clock();

  protected BaseTask(int id) {
    mId = id;
    mExecutionTime = getTimeMillis();
  }

  /**
   * Modify the task ID to prevent arbitrary task from executing. Can only be called before {@link
   * #onCreate(Context, Intent, int, int)} returns.
   */
  @MainThread
  public void setId(int id) {
    Assert.isMainThread();
    mId = id;
  }

  @MainThread
  public boolean hasStarted() {
    Assert.isMainThread();
    return mHasStarted;
  }

  @MainThread
  public boolean hasFailed() {
    Assert.isMainThread();
    return mHasFailed;
  }

  public Context getContext() {
    return mContext;
  }

  public PhoneAccountHandle getPhoneAccountHandle() {
    return mPhoneAccountHandle;
  }
  /**
   * Should be call in the constructor or {@link Policy#onCreate(BaseTask, Intent, int, int)} will
   * be missed.
   */
  @MainThread
  public BaseTask addPolicy(Policy policy) {
    Assert.isMainThread();
    mPolicies.add(policy);
    return this;
  }

  /**
   * Indicate the task has failed. {@link Policy#onFail()} will be triggered once the execution
   * ends. This mechanism is used by policies for actions such as determining whether to schedule a
   * retry. Must be call inside {@link #onExecuteInBackgroundThread()}
   */
  @WorkerThread
  public void fail() {
    Assert.isNotMainThread();
    mHasFailed = true;
  }

  @MainThread
  public void setExecutionTime(long timeMillis) {
    Assert.isMainThread();
    mExecutionTime = timeMillis;
  }

  public long getTimeMillis() {
    return sClock.getTimeMillis();
  }

  /**
   * Creates an intent that can be used to restart the current task. Derived class should build
   * their intent upon this.
   */
  public Intent createRestartIntent() {
    return createIntent(getContext(), this.getClass(), mPhoneAccountHandle);
  }

  /**
   * Creates an intent that can be used to start the {@link TaskSchedulerService}. Derived class
   * should build their intent upon this.
   */
  public static Intent createIntent(
      Context context, Class<? extends BaseTask> task, PhoneAccountHandle phoneAccountHandle) {
    Intent intent = TaskSchedulerService.createIntent(context, task);
    intent.putExtra(EXTRA_PHONE_ACCOUNT_HANDLE, phoneAccountHandle);
    return intent;
  }

  @Override
  public TaskId getId() {
    return new TaskId(mId, mPhoneAccountHandle);
  }

  @Override
  @CallSuper
  public void onCreate(Context context, Intent intent, int flags, int startId) {
    mContext = context;
    mPhoneAccountHandle = intent.getParcelableExtra(EXTRA_PHONE_ACCOUNT_HANDLE);
    for (Policy policy : mPolicies) {
      policy.onCreate(this, intent, flags, startId);
    }
  }

  @Override
  public long getReadyInMilliSeconds() {
    return mExecutionTime - getTimeMillis();
  }

  @Override
  @CallSuper
  public void onBeforeExecute() {
    for (Policy policy : mPolicies) {
      policy.onBeforeExecute();
    }
    mHasStarted = true;
  }

  @Override
  @CallSuper
  public void onCompleted() {
    if (mHasFailed) {
      for (Policy policy : mPolicies) {
        policy.onFail();
      }
    }

    for (Policy policy : mPolicies) {
      policy.onCompleted();
    }
  }

  @Override
  public void onDuplicatedTaskAdded(Task task) {
    for (Policy policy : mPolicies) {
      policy.onDuplicatedTaskAdded();
    }
  }

  @NeededForTesting
  static class Clock {

    public long getTimeMillis() {
      return SystemClock.elapsedRealtime();
    }
  }

  /** Used to replace the clock with an deterministic clock */
  @NeededForTesting
  static void setClockForTesting(Clock clock) {
    sClock = clock;
  }
}
